These are my fourth pair of Sabrina boots (black leather, forest green suede, cognac brogue, and now these gorgeous red). Color is a little darker and richer than what is shown here but that's not a bad thing! A word about how these wear: they are pretty substantial (read: heavy!) and that may be a challenge for some; they are also very stiff at first and do take a few wears to break - in hence the 4 stars for comfort. If you're patient and take the time to allow the leather to relax and don't mind the weight, you will get many many years of wear out of them. Frye's quality has suffered as of late, as I've worn the brand for ages, but these are one of the few styles still made in America - something I can whole-heartedly support. The craftsmanship is amazing and well worth the investment.

This is my fourth pair of Frye shoes--two pairs of boots and two pairs of flats. The Sabrina 6G Lace Up has continued the tradition of excellent craftsmanship to which I have grown accustomed. They are very comfortable and, more importantly, beautiful up close. I receive compliments every time I wear them. And I've worn them a lot. With dresses, jeans, skirts. And I think they will pair very well with shorts and tights in the fall. To be sure, they are hard to get on, but that gets easier over time. Oh! And if you want to use a leather cream on them, Frye's did very well and didn't darken the leather too much at all.

I have these in a couple of colors - tan, red and black. The tan are really the most utilitarian, believe it or not. I had serious reluctance about buying them, but they're the ones that actually look better with use. The black are good also, and the red are beautiful when you buy them, but it hurts to put that first crease in them, because they're so expensive. But I feel fierce in these shoes, and can't stop wearing them.

I love these boots! I am in between an 8 and 8 1/2 but have feet that are towards the narrow side. I ordered the 8 and they fit perfectly. I've never had a shoe fit me so well straight out of the box. Maybe it is because my feet are narrow but even so, I find so many women's shoes that squish your toes. These actually have space in the foot bed yet my heels do not slip. If you are debating like I was, get them! They are beautiful. I now want them in more colors. One thing of note is that I got the oiled suede so maybe there is more give than the leather? Also, this is my first pair of Frye boots. I have returned others for being too big and heel slippage.
